Re my post at #10, above, I thought readers might appreciate an update.

As I suspected would happen my dealers have failed to resolve my crashing Infotainment screen issue and a replacement control unit is now on order from VW. I'm told that two other customers at the dealership are ahead of me in the queue for the part, so clearly it's not an isolated issue.
